Baerbel Mueller and Juergen Strohmayer create concrete gallery in Accra

Architect Baerbel Mueller and architectural designer Juergen Strohmayer have created a multi-use gallery for the Nubuke Foundation in Ghana.
Named Nubuke Extended, the one-room rectangular building is an extension to the arts and culture institution's headquarters in Accra.Built by the entrance to the Nubuke Foundation grounds, the elevated concrete gallery is raised above the organisation's gardens.
